The repository contains the scripts to produce the figures in the paper: "Neubauer, D., Ferrachat, S., Siegenthaler-Le Drian, C., Stier, P. Partridge, D. G., Tegen, I., Bey, I., Stanelle, T., Kokkola, H., and Lohmann, U.: The global aerosol-climate model ECHAM6.3-HAM2.3 – Part 2: Cloud evaluation, aerosol radiative forcing and climate sensitivity, Geosci. Mod. Dev., https://doi.org/10.5194/gmd-2018-307, 2019." Note that the data is to be found in the accompanying package (http://dx.doi.org/10.5281/zenodo.2541936)
